The Project or Construction Manager represents the client and protects their interests. They coordinate and supervise all contractors and teams, ensuring economic control, quality, deadlines and overall coherence.
The main contractor, by contrast, is responsible for the physical execution of the works: organising teams, hiring subcontractors and performing part of the works directly.
The appropriate model depends on the type and scale of the project and the degree of control desired by the client.

  • If you are in the idea or definition phase: the right service is Project Management, where we define scope, viability and strategic planning —technical, financial and operational— to ensure an integrated approach.
  •  If the project is already defined and entering execution: the right service is Construction Management, overseeing all works with full control of cost, time and quality.
  •  Once the project is completed: Facility Management ensures optimal, sustainable and energy-efficient operation of the asset over time through preventive maintenance and continuous improvement.

This continuity avoids duplication and ensures technical, economic and strategic coherence across the entire lifecycle of the project.
